The chipboard was altered by coating in black gesso followed by Distress Oxide sprays and waxes. While it was drying, I went to work on my background. First a coat of heavy white gesso was applied. Next, I used collage medium to lay a piece of torn decoupage paper. Once this was dry I added clear crackle to the inner portion of my cover and white crackle paste to the outer area. I left this to dry for several hours to get maximun crackle result. Next, lots of inks and oxides! Be sure to dry with a heat tool between colors to prevent muddiness.

Achieving an aged look is a process but so worth it in the end! For mine I have used Distress Oxides, Distress Sprays, and some black ink as well.

Finally I added my dried chipboard to the cover, followed by the flowers and other bits. Final touches of wax and splatter were added as well.
